Alright, now on to the beauty. ‘Cindy’ reminds me a bit of ‘Marilyn’, ‘Marilyn’ is a deeper gorgeous redĀ and ‘Cindy’ is a little brighter red glitter.

Picture 112

‘Cindy’ on it’s own is suspended in a somewhat clear, red base. IĀ applied two coats of ‘Cindy’ over ‘Nubar – Lustful Red’

Today I have a simple mani, almost too simple, the contrast I don’t feel is enough for pictures. If you know these colors and have ever put them together its enough contrast in person, however in pictures it keeps blending, so we will see what you think.

Overtop two coats of OPI’s Nail Envy, I painted two coats of “China Glaze – Dorothy Who”, I then with my dotting tools did two coats of “Essie – Aruba Blue” as a frame around all nails.
